Transaction 66a6c6917fd6e32b2816a835f7ba0fecd09eb1e1b08eaac442920a88fafc54b9
1 Input
1 Output
-
66a6c6917fd6e32b2816a835f7ba0fecd09eb1e1b08eaac442920a88fafc54b9:0
- value
- 200226093
- script pubkey
- OP_0 OP_PUSHBYTES_20 f87e0f4475a5e0d90ff4c65731372d6232c8b167
- address
- bc1qlplq73r45hsdjrl5cetnzdedvgev3vt8y3fa2q